Transaction e768cbcea581660322691bb38ccc51578e039b7c104de4566e6f2c58a245521b
1 Input
1 Output
-
e768cbcea581660322691bb38ccc51578e039b7c104de4566e6f2c58a245521b:0
- value
- 10000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f7590a3e6e8c40ee41f24f911d8759babf156b33 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PYrZzU8bUBb8qwzDfb92xq3A3x4n5cw3R